Well shaped crystals of NiNb2O6 were obtained by CVT. using Cl2 (added as PtCl2) or NH4Cl as transport agents (1020-degrees-C --> 960-degrees-C). As a result of thermodynamic calculations the migration of NiNb2O6 in the temperature gradient in the presence of Cl2 can be expressed by the heterogenous endothermic equilibrium (1). NiNb2O6,s + 4Cl2,g = NiCl2,g + 2NbOCl3,g + 2O2,g (1) Assuming DELTA(B)H298-degrees(NiNb2O6,s) = -524.4 kcal/mol a satisfying agreement between thermodynamical calculation and experimental results can be reached. NH4Cl is less suitable as transport agent, because Ni2+ is partly reduced to the metal by NH3. The additionally H2O produced by this reduction leads to a less favourable equilibrium position of (2) and to low deposition rates. NiNb2O6,s + 8HClg = NiCl2,g + 2NbOCl3,g + 4H2Og (2)
